Time
5
Singapore is eight hours ahead of Greenwich Mean Time (GMT).

Currency / Currency Exchange
5
The local currency is the Singapore dollar. Foreign currencies can be changed either in banks or with a moneychanger conveniently located around the island.

Water & Electricity
5
Water from the tap is safe for drinking in Singapore. Electricity used in Singapore is 220 to 240 volts AC, 50 Hz. Most hotels can provide visitors with a transformer, which can convert the voltage to 110-120 volts.

Tipping
5
Tipping is not a way of life in Singapore. It is prohibited at the airport and discouraged at hotels and restaurants where there is a 10% service charge.

Information on Visa Application
5
National passport holders of most countries are permitted to stay in Singapore for up to 14 days without visas. However visas may be required for visitors from some other countries and participants are requested to clarify this before travelling. You should have valid passports, onward/return tickets, onward facilities (e.g. visas, entry permits, etc) to the next destination and sufficient funds for your stay in Singapore.

Airport
5
The Singapore International (Changi) Airport has three terminals, Terminal 1, 2 and 3. Each airline operates at only one of the three terminals. Transport to the city is available by MRT (Mass Rapid Transit), Airbus (airport bus), local bus services or taxis. Travelling time into the city is approximately 20 minutes.
